🧠The Brain: A Quiet Supercomputer
Your brain processes more information in a single second than the most powerful computers did just decades ago.
It runs silently, without loading screens or error messages, adjusting to your mood, environment, and habits.
What’s fascinating is not its power, but its flexibility. The brain rewires itself constantly. New experiences create new neural paths. New routines slowly change the way you think and react.
That’s why small habits matter. A short walk, a new book, or learning one new idea a day can literally reshape how your brain works. Progress doesn’t always feel dramatic — but it’s happening.
